清华大学出版社 TSINGHUA UNIVERSITY PRESS 例5.3有一函数: y=-1(x<0) 0(x=0) 1(x>0) 编一程序,输入一个x值,输出y值。 可以先写出算法: 输入x 若x<0y=-1;若x=0y=0;若x>0y=1 输出y或输入x 若x<0y=-1 否则: 若x=0y=0;若x>0y=1 输出y。也可以用流程图表示,见图5.7。例5.3有一函数: y=-1(x<0) 0(x=0) 1(x>0) 编一程序,输入一个x值,输出y值。 可以先写出算法: 输入x 若 x < 0y =-1;若 x = 0y = 0;若 x > 0y = 1 输出y或输入x 若 x < 0y = -1 否则: 若 x = 0y = 0;若 x > 0y = 1 输出y。也可以用流程图表示,见图5.7